Job description

To provide clinical interventions to designated patients, both physio and occupational therapy, within scope of practice, on behalf of qualified practitioners within the multidisciplinary team. To supervise and delegate work to more junior staff within the team. To be involved in service development to include delivering training as appropriate to other members of the team.

Main duties of the job

Key responsibilities:

  • The post holder is responsible for actively participating as part of the Multi-disciplinary Team (MDT) to carry out specific planned treatments/interventions within tested areas of competency which help to improve client’s quality of life/functional abilities/wellbeing so enabling them to remain within their own environment, preventing admission to hospital or other residential accommodation as well as facilitating early discharge from hospital.
  • To review treatment care plans making necessary modifications prior to reporting back to a qualified staff member.
  • To assess for and provide equipment; assess and process requests for minor adaptations.
  • To provide support and training to other staff within the team.

To proactively monitor and review the non-qualified caseload and actively monitor patients escalating both when deteriorating and when requiring transition from the service.

Car ownership and the ability to drive is a requirement of this role as this is a community post.

Person specification
Knowledge and Experience
  • Completion of NVQ L4 or Foundation Degree level or equivalent in health related subject
  • Grade C or above GCSEs or equivalent in English and Maths
  • Experience of working with physically impaired people in a therapeutic environment
  • Working knowledge of medical conditions commonly seen within Health Care area e.g. Stroke, Parkinson’s Disease, Orthopaedic conditions, Diabetes, amputations, Multiple Sclerosis etc and how this impacts on the patient
Skills and Abilities
  • Evidence of extended competencies especially with patients in the community
  • Experience of working within a pressured environment
  • Good verbal and written communication
  • Experience with S1
